F1 Midweek Report - China

In the wake of Lewis Hamilton's third successive victory, it appears that the 2014 World Championship is there for the winning for the Englishman. Joining David Garrido in the studio to discuss Hamilton's victory and reflect on the Shanghai event are Ben Hunt, the F1 correspondent of The Sun, and Mark Hutcheson, former race engineer at the likes of Red Bull, Marussia and HRT. With the season just four races old, there's plenty to discuss, with this week's show focusing on: * What effect Hamilton's run of victories might be having on team-mate Nico Rosberg. * Why Sebastian Vettel is struggling this season and struggling to keep up with Daniel Ricciardo. * Whether Ferrari are on the way back...
